Description

This is an early 19th-century terrace of houses located on Gote Road, similar in style to Nos. 5-19. The terrace comprises two storeys and has a cement-rendered exterior with a slate roof. The houses have panelled doors set within plain stone architraves. Sash windows with 12 and 16 panes are also set in plain stone architraves. A long stair window is visible on the left-hand return side of No. 21, featuring a Gothic label and an ogee head. Nos. 5 to 19 (odd), Nos. 21 to 27 (odd), and Derwent Bridge House are designated as a group with Derwent Bridge.
